Output 6706c264422a691e490afda3d6db95cbaccb59399662e133b7829fac533857dd:7

value
37804346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b334667e14790e6ea6aefbdde3cb4d73abf7eb5a OP_EQUAL
address
MQEhxcG9HgkQVhWGAx9KvndzroU5yqYr1D
transaction
6706c264422a691e490afda3d6db95cbaccb59399662e133b7829fac533857dd
spent
true